Hello, Freespirit! Could you share your primary inspirations and influences on your music journey?
“Thank you for having me! It’s truly a pleasure to chat with you. My music journey began at 16 when I started performing in local bars in my hometown. A pivotal moment came when I visited Mykonos, where I had the chance to perform at various beach clubs. My first gig at Cavo Paradiso was transformative; I’ve been returning every summer ever since!”
Versatility plays a crucial role in dance music. How did your style originate, and in what ways has it evolved over the years?
“I’ve always been drawn to powerful drums and heavy basslines. Artists like Danny Tenaglia, Steve Lawler, and Chus & Ceballos heavily influenced my musical palette. My style has certainly evolved, but I aim to maintain a blend of groove, emotion, and energy, staying true to my artistic identity.”
Being a pillar in Cavo Paradiso for more than two decades, how has this venue shaped your career?
“Residency at Cavo Paradiso is an unmatched experience. This summer marks my 26th season here. I consider it a big school, teaching me how to adapt to various crowds. The diverse nature of the performances—opening, peak-time, and after-hours—has made me a more flexible DJ. It’s a tremendous opportunity to learn from world-class artists and to stay attuned to the latest trends in the industry.”

As the A&R for Cavo Paradiso Records, what sets this label apart, and how would you describe its identity?
“I spearheaded the relaunch of Cavo Paradiso Records with a fresh concept focusing on quality dancefloor music across genres. Since the club hosts a variety of styles during summer, our label mirrors this philosophy. We connect with top artists for exclusive demos and also nurture emerging talent, providing a platform for their creations. Additionally, we offer limited colored vinyl editions for our best-selling tracks each year, giving clubbers a unique memento.”

With significant international shows approaching, could you walk us through your upcoming events and your preparation process?
“This upcoming season is incredibly thrilling for me. I’m set to perform at festivals like Electric Love in Salzburg and Untold Festival in Romania, alongside my residency at Cavo Paradiso. I’ll share stages with artists like Diplo and Meduza. Later, I’ll return to one of my favorite places in Ibiza at Hï Ibiza and lead a Cavo Paradiso takeover at Ministry of Sound in London.”

Can you share any hints about your upcoming releases and recent collaborations?
“This year has been rich in new music. I’ve collaborated on a few tracks with Eran and created a remix for Claptone’s album, ‘Wanderlust.’ Moreover, I’m excited to team up with my good friend High Notes, releasing tracks on Side of the Moon and MoBlack. I’ve also worked with Marasi, Melo, and the legendary Glenn Morrison on projects slated for release later this year.”
